Oriana Awwad is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ology and Geriatrics and Gerontology. According to data from OpenAlex, Oriana Awwad has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 767 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Molecular Biology, 7 papers in Oncology and 6 papers in Geriatrics and Gerontology. Recurrent topics in Oriana Awwad's work include Pharmaceutical Practices and Patient Outcomes (6 papers), Adenosine and Purinergic Signaling (6 papers) and Gastroesophageal reflux and treatments (3 papers). Oriana Awwad is often cited by papers focused on Pharmaceutical Practices and Patient Outcomes (6 papers), Adenosine and Purinergic Signaling (6 papers) and Gastroesophageal reflux and treatments (3 papers). Oriana Awwad collaborates with scholars based in Jordan, Italy and United Arab Emirates. Oriana Awwad's co-authors include Rocchina Colucci, Corrado Blandizzi, Matteo Fornai, Luca Antonioli, Marco Tuccori, Mario Rotondi, Francesca Coperchini, Luca Chiovato, Ferruccio Santini and Marcello Imbriani and has published in prestigious journals such as Gastroenterology, PLoS ONE and Scientific Reports.
